Tour Itinerary

Enjoy an unforgettable day exploring the wonders of the Red Sea at Ras Mohamed National Park, renowned worldwide for its crystal-clear waters, vibrant coral reefs, and over 1,000 species of colorful fish. With exceptional underwater visibility, it’s a dream destination for snorkelers and nature lovers alike.

Your journey begins with hotel pickup around 8:00 AM, followed by a short drive to the marina where your boat awaits. After a scenic 45-minute cruise, you’ll arrive at your first snorkeling site.

The tour includes three snorkeling stops—two in the rich waters of Ras Mohamed and the third at the stunning White Island. At each snorkeling spot, you’ll spend about 30 to 45 minutes discovering the marine life, while the final stop gives you time to relax and enjoy the beauty of the island for about an hour.

The trip concludes around 5:00 PM, after which you’ll be comfortably transferred back to your hotel.

  • Yes, Egypt is generally safe for tourists, especially in popular areas such as Cairo, Luxor, Aswan, and the Red Sea resorts. However, it's always advisable to check travel advisories from your government, stay in well-traveled areas, and follow local security guidelines.

  • Tourists in Egypt should dress modestly, follow visa regulations, and avoid using drones. Photography of military sites, government buildings, or locals without consent is prohibited. Additionally, touching or climbing on historical monuments is strictly forbidden.

  • Tipping (or "baksheesh") is not usually included in the tour price. It is customary to tip guides, drivers, hotel staff, and restaurant servers as a token of appreciation. It is recommended to carry small bills for this purpose.
